Description du poste
Job Responsibilities
  • Contribute to the Commodity Strategy within their perimeter.
  • Prepare and manage RFQ (Request for Quotation) aligned with the defined Bidlist and commodity strategy.
  • Make supplier recommendations (REC) during Sourcing Table decision meetings.
  • Generate Purchase Agreements (contracts) based on supplier selections (REC).
  • Ensure contract execution, quality, logistics, development performance, and capacity increases.
  • Manage escalation levels with suppliers regarding quality, logistics, and obsolescence when needed.
  • Negotiate and monitor purchasing performance using various levers such as commercial performance, Monozokuri, Value Optimization (VO), and raw material indexation/optimization.
  • Coordinate and prepare business reviews with suppliers.
  • Handle administrative tasks related to these activities (purchase orders, amendments, etc.).
  • Recommend suppliers considering sourcing timing, cost targets, and commodity strategy.
  • Draft and ensure the signing of Purchase Agreements and General Terms & Conditions (GT&Cs).
  • Achieve economic performance, including VO, aligned with Division and Commodity Group targets.
  • Provide resourcing recommendations in line with Division and Commodity Group targets.
  • Maintain quality, logistics, and Vehicle Off Road (VOR) performance in line with Purchasing Division targets.
  • Manage all business administration linked to this position.
